Pentel: A Legacy of Quality

Brand History: Pentel, a name synonymous with quality stationery, has been around since 1946. Founded in Japan, Pentel quickly gained recognition for its innovative writing instruments. Over the decades, it has expanded globally, becoming a trusted brand in the stationery industry.

Market Reputation: Pentel is renowned for its durability and precision. The brand has a loyal customer base that swears by its products. Whether you’re a student, an artist, or a professional, Pentel mechanical pencils are often the go-to choice.

Product Features: Pentel mechanical pencils are known for their smooth writing experience, thanks to the advanced lead technology. They offer a variety of models, from basic to premium, with features like ergonomic grips, adjustable lead sizes, and refillable mechanisms. Pentel also emphasizes sustainability, with many of its products made from recycled materials.

Pilot: Innovation Meets Style

Brand History: Pilot, another Japanese giant, has been crafting writing instruments since 1918. With a rich history of innovation, Pilot has consistently pushed the boundaries of what’s possible in the stationery world.

Market Reputation: Pilot mechanical pencils are celebrated for their sleek design and cutting-edge technology. The brand is particularly popular among young professionals and students who appreciate the blend of style and functionality.

Product Features: Pilot mechanical pencils often feature unique designs, such as retractable tips and twist-advance mechanisms. They also offer a range of lead hardness options, catering to different writing needs. Pilot’s commitment to quality is evident in its use of high-grade materials and precise manufacturing processes.

Rotring: Precision Engineering

Brand History: Rotring, a German brand founded in 1928, is synonymous with precision engineering. It has a long-standing reputation for producing high-quality drafting and technical drawing instruments.

Market Reputation: Rotring mechanical pencils are highly regarded in the architectural, engineering, and design communities. They are known for their accuracy, durability, and professional appearance.

Product Features: Rotring mechanical pencils are designed with precision in mind. They often feature metal barrels, fixed sleeves, and advanced lead guidance systems. Rotring also offers a range of accessories, such as lead pointers and erasers, to complement its pencils.

Let’s start with lead refilling mechanisms. There are primarily two types: twist-advance and click-advance. Twist-advance pencils, as the name suggests, require you to twist the barrel to extend the lead. This mechanism is often preferred for its simplicity and the fact that it reduces the risk of accidentally dropping the lead. On the other hand, click-advance pencils use a button or a plunger mechanism to extend the lead with a simple press. This type is favored for its speed and convenience, especially during fast-paced note-taking sessions. A study published in ScienceDirect highlights the efficiency of click-advance mechanisms in enhancing writing speed and reducing hand strain.

Next up is grip comfort. The grip of a mechanical pencil can significantly impact your writing experience. Some pencils feature a rubberized or textured grip area, which provides excellent traction and reduces hand fatigue during prolonged use. These are ideal for students or professionals who spend a lot of time writing or drawing. Other models might have a smooth, metallic grip, which, while aesthetically pleasing, might not offer the same level of comfort for extended periods. It’s important to consider who will be using the pencils and for what purpose when evaluating grip comfort.

Now, let’s talk about writing smoothness. This is perhaps the most subjective aspect, as it depends on personal preference and the intended use of the pencil. Some mechanical pencils are designed with a fine tip and a lighter lead, making them perfect for detailed work or sketching. These pencils often glide smoothly across the paper, providing a clean, precise line. Others might have a slightly thicker lead and a heavier feel, which can be beneficial for those who prefer a more substantial writing experience or need to write on rougher surfaces.

When it comes to buying wholesale mechanical pencils, one of the most critical factors to consider is the price. You want to ensure that you’re getting the best value for your money without compromising on quality. Let’s dive into the different price ranges of wholesale mechanical pencils and analyze the cost-effectiveness of products in each segment.

Budget-Friendly Options: $0.50 – $1.50 per Pencil

In the lower price range, you’ll find a variety of wholesale mechanical pencils that are perfect for those on a tight budget. These pencils are often made from basic materials like plastic or lightweight metal, which helps keep costs down. While they may not have all the bells and whistles of higher-end models, they still offer decent performance.

One of the main advantages of these budget-friendly pencils is their affordability. You can buy a large quantity without breaking the bank, making them ideal for bulk purchases or promotional giveaways. However, it’s important to note that the quality may vary within this price range. Some pencils may have issues with lead breakage or inconsistent writing flow, so it’s a good idea to do some research and read reviews before making a purchase.

Mid-Range Picks: $1.50 – $3.00 per Pencil

Moving up to the mid-range price segment, you’ll find wholesale mechanical pencils that offer a better balance between price and quality. These pencils often feature more durable materials, such as higher-grade plastics or aluminum, which contribute to their improved performance and longevity.

In this price range, you can expect to find pencils with smoother writing experiences, thanks to better lead advancement mechanisms and more precise manufacturing. They may also come with additional features like ergonomic grips or retractable tips, enhancing user comfort and convenience. For businesses looking for a reliable option that won’t break the bank, mid-range wholesale mechanical pencils are a great choice.

Premium Choices: Above $3.00 per Pencil

At the top end of the price spectrum, you’ll encounter premium wholesale mechanical pencils that are designed for those who demand the very best. These pencils are crafted from high-quality materials, such as brass or stainless steel, and often feature intricate designs and finishes.

In addition to their superior build quality, premium mechanical pencils offer exceptional writing performance. They typically have precise lead advancement systems, ensuring smooth and consistent writing with minimal lead breakage. Some models even come with customizable features, allowing you to personalize your writing experience. While these pencils come with a higher price tag, they are often worth the investment for businesses that prioritize quality and performance.

Analyzing Cost-Effectiveness

When evaluating the cost-effectiveness of wholesale mechanical pencils, it’s essential to consider not just the upfront price but also the long-term value. A budget-friendly pencil may seem like a great deal initially, but if it breaks easily or performs poorly, you may end up spending more in the long run on replacements.

On the other hand, a premium pencil may have a higher initial cost, but its durability and superior performance can make it a more cost-effective choice in the long term. Mid-range pencils often strike a good balance between price and quality, offering a reliable option for most businesses.

Factors Influencing Price

Several factors can influence the price of wholesale mechanical pencils. The materials used in construction play a significant role, with higher-quality materials like metal generally costing more than plastic. According to a market report from Cognitive Market Research, the demand for metal-based mechanical pencils has been on the rise due to their perceived durability and premium feel. The brand reputation also affects pricing, as well-known brands often command a premium due to their established quality and customer loyalty. Additionally, features such as ergonomic designs, advanced lead advancement mechanisms, and customizable options can add to the overall cost.
